Catwoman by Louise Simonson
Soulstealer
In this thrilling tale, the iconic anti-heroine navigates the shadowy streets of Gotham City, balancing her dual life as a cunning cat burglar and a woman with a complex moral compass. As she embarks on a daring heist, she finds herself entangled in a web of deceit and danger, facing formidable foes and unexpected allies. With her sharp wit and unmatched agility, she must outsmart those who threaten her freedom while confronting her own inner demons. The story delves into themes of identity, loyalty, and redemption, offering a gripping exploration of a character who walks the fine line between villain and hero.
